- 1、本文档共36页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
计算机组成原理第一章剖析
计算机组成原理 第一篇 概论 第一章 计算机系统概论 1.1 计算机系统简介 1.2 计算机的基本组成 1.3 计算机硬件的主要技术指标 本章重点 本章重点突出计算机组成的概貌和框架,如下图所示。 第一章 计算机系统概论 1.1计算机系统简介 一、计算机的软硬件概念 硬件——组成计算机的各种实际装置的总称。 特点:看得见摸得着。 软件——计算机运行所需的各种程序及相关 资料。分类是? 特点:看不见摸不着。 两者的关系:相辅相成,缺一不可。 (硬件是基础,软件是灵魂) 二、计算机系统的层次结构 计算机系统的多级层次结构: 虚拟机——计算机系统对于不同层次上的使用者来说,可看成是一台具有这一层次功能的计算机,而不考虑实际机器(硬件)的功能。为与实机相区别,称“虚拟机”。 三、区别 “结构 ”、“组成 ” 计算机系统结构(Computer Architecture) ——指那些能被程序员(汇编、机器语言编程)所见到的计算机系统的属性(指令集、数据类型等)。 计算机组成(Computer Organization) ——指计算机系统结构所给属性的逻辑实现(指令的实现、如何传送指令、运算等)。 注意区别两个概念! 四、系列机的概念 系列机——同一厂家生产、具有相同的系统结构,但有不同组成和实现的一系列不同型号的机器。 特点:软件具有向上兼容,向后兼容性。 一、计算机的特点(优点): a、记忆能力强 计算机可以长久的存储大量的文字、图形、声音等信息资料。 b、 快速处理能力 数据处理是人类社会的重要活动,很多场合处理速度起着决定作用。 c、足够高的计算精度 通常情况下,数值精度预置为15位有效数字。 d、自动完成各种操作 计算机能自动执行存放在内存中的程序。 e、复杂的逻辑判断能力 计算机的智能特点主要表现在它的逻辑判断能力上。 二、冯·诺依曼计算机的特点: 1、由五大部件组成; 2、指令和数据以二进制存放,可按地址寻访; 3、指令由操作码和地址码组成; 4、指令在存储器内一般按顺序存放; 5、机器以运算器为中心,各设备间数据传送均经过运算器。 几个概念:CPU、I/O设备、ALU、CU、MM、主机。 计算机也可看成由主机和I/O设备两大部分组成。用这种观点描述的计算机组成框图如下: 四、计算机的工作过程: 两大步骤:准备,上机 1. 上机前的准备工作:三步 ①建立数学模型; ②确定计算方法; ③编程。 实 例 例:计算ax2+bx+c的机器语言程序清单如下图所示: 细化的计算机组成框图(运算器): 表1.1 各寄存器存放的操作数含义 寄存器操作常用描述方法 ——寄存器传送语言: X:X寄存器名 [X]:X寄存器中的内容 M:存储器某一单元名 [M]:存储器某单元内容 细化的计算机组成框图(控制器): 细化的计算机组成框图(I/O设备): 细化的计算机组成框图(存储器): 1.3 计算机硬件的主要技术指标 一、机器字长: CPU能同时处理的数据位数,即数据字长。 相关概念: 存储字长:一个存储单元可存放的二进制位数。 指令字长:一条指令所具有的二进制代码位数。 字节(Byte):计算机中另一种数据的表示单位。一个标准字节被规定为8位二进制代码。 三种字长的关系: 早期:三者相同; 当前:通常规定: 存储字长 = 机器字长 = 字节的2n倍; 例:常见字长 = 8位、16位、32位、64位等,分别称为8位机、16位机、32位机、64位机。 指令字长 = 字节的整数倍; 例:单字节指令、双字节指令、三字节指令等。 二、存储容量:(仅讨论主存) 例1:64KΧ32位(或216Χ32位)
文档评论(0)